1. 服务简介与应用场景
FunASR 是阿里巴巴开源的语音识别工具包,支持多场景一键部署,适合会议转写、客服质检、字幕生成、语音助手、医疗法律文档整理、多语言识别等实际业务需求。
1.1 典型应用场景
- 会议/讲座/采访转写:实时或离线将录音转为带时间戳文本,便于归档检索。
- 智能客服与语音质检:实时识别对话内容,支持热词、敏感词检测、服务分析。
- 媒体内容字幕生成:批量处理音视频,自动生成带时间轴字幕文本。
- 语音助手与人机交互:低延迟识别,适合智能音箱、车载、移动端。
- 医疗、法律文档整理:支持专业热词,提升术语识别准确率。
- 多语言识别与翻译前处理:支持多语种、口音,适合国际会议、跨国企业。
2. 部署与接入
2.1 共绩算力平台部署步骤
1.登录共绩算力控制台,在首页点击“弹性部署服务”。

2.选择 GPU 型号(推荐 1 卡 4090)。

3.在“服务配置”选择 FunASR API 官方镜像。
4.点击“部署服务”,平台自动拉取镜像并启动容器。

5.部署完成后,在“快捷访问”中复制端口为 10095 的公网访问链接,即为 API 服务地址。
点击 10095 的端口会进入不到具体页面,这个是正常现象,直接复制地址到您的对应服务中使用 API 服务即可,可以参考下面的示例程序。

3. API 协议与参数
3.1 通信协议
WebSocket 协议,服务地址:wss://d07171047-funasr-online-server-318-kmkzg1m4-10095.550c.cloud
3.2 典型调用流程
- 连接 WebSocket 服务。
- 发送配置参数(JSON)。
- 分块发送音频数据(bytes)。
- 发送结束标志(
{"is_speaking": false})。 - 接收识别结果(JSON)。
3.3 配置参数说明
| 参数 | 类型 | 说明 |
| chunk_size | array | 流式模型延迟配置,数组格式,如 [5,10,5] |
| wav_name | string | 音频文件名 |
| is_speaking | boolean | 说话状态/断句尾点标识 true表示正在说话,false表示语句结束 |
| wav_format | string | 音频格式,支持 pcm |
| chunk_interval | number | 块间隔时间(单位毫秒) |
| itn | boolean | 是否逆文本标准化true开启(如将“一二三”转为“123”) |
| mode | string | 识别模式:2pass(双通混合模式)、online(纯流式)、offline(非流式) |
| hotwords | string | 热词配置,JSON 字符串如:{"科技词":0.8,"人名":1.2}) |
4. 典型场景与实测程序
4.1 中文音频识别实测示例(test_cn_male_9s.pcm)
import asyncio
import websockets
import json
ws_url = "wss://d07171047-funasr-online-server-318-kmkzg1m4-10095.550c.cloud"
async def test_asr(audio_file, wav_name):
config = {
"chunk_size": [5, 10, 5],
"wav_name": wav_name,
"is_speaking": True,
"wav_format": "pcm",
"chunk_interval": 10,
"itn": True,
"mode": "2pass"
}
async with websockets.connect(ws_url) as ws:
await ws.send(json.dumps(config, ensure_ascii=False))
with open(audio_file, "rb") as f:
while True:
chunk = f.read(8000)
if not chunk:
break
await ws.send(chunk)
await ws.send(json.dumps({"is_speaking": False}))
while True:
try:
resp = await asyncio.wait_for(ws.recv(), timeout=5)
print(f"{audio_file} 识别结果:", resp)
if 'is_final' in resp and json.loads(resp).get('is_final'):
break
except asyncio.TimeoutError:
break
if __name__ == "__main__":
asyncio.run(test_asr("test_cn_male_9s.pcm", "test_cn_male_9s"))
实际输出:
test_cn_male_9s.pcm 识别结果: {"is_final":true,"mode":"2pass-offline","stamp_sents":[...],"text":"这是一期非广告视频,给你们介绍一下我养猫。这 3 年用到 过最好用的几样养猫物品。","timestamp":"[[50,150],[150,250],...]
主要内容:
这是一期非广告视频,给你们介绍一下我养猫。这 3 年用到过最好用的几样养猫物品。

4.4 智能客服与语音质检(热词增强)
import asyncio
import websockets
import json
ws_url = "wss://console.suanli.cn/serverless/idc/3576"
async def customer_service_asr():
hotwords = {"产品 A": 30, "专有名词": 25, "投诉": 20}
config = {
"chunk_size": [5, 10, 5],
"wav_name": "service_demo",
"is_speaking": True,
"wav_format": "pcm",
"chunk_interval": 10,
"itn": True,
"mode": "online",
"hotwords": json.dumps(hotwords, ensure_ascii=False)
}
audio_file = "service_call_8k.pcm"
async with websockets.connect(ws_url) as ws:
await ws.send(json.dumps(config, ensure_ascii=False))
with open(audio_file, "rb") as f:
while True:
chunk = f.read(8000)
if not chunk:
break
await ws.send(chunk)
await ws.send(json.dumps({"is_speaking": False}))
while True:
try:
resp = await asyncio.wait_for(ws.recv(), timeout=5)
print("客服识别:", resp)
# 示例输出:{"is_final":true,"text":"您好,欢迎致电产品 A 客服..."}
if 'is_final' in resp and json.loads(resp).get('is_final'):
break
except asyncio.TimeoutError:
break
asyncio.run(customer_service_asr())

5. 常见问题与参考资料
音频需为 8kHz 单声道 PCM,建议用 ffmpeg 或 sox 转换
